The king of Morocco owns an impressive castle in French territory, located in the commune of Betz, in the department of Oise, approximately 70 kilometres from Paris, which corresponds to about an hour's travel from the French capital. The property spans 71 hectares of land.
According to the report, the castle is said to have been put up for sale. However, no details are provided regarding the asking price for the property or any potential interested buyers.
The property is entirely private and not open to tourist visits, which contrasts with other French castles that operate as cultural attractions and historical monuments accessible to the public.
